Residual Value
The projected worth of a tangible asset upon reaching the conclusion of its operational lifespan.
Depreciation Expense
An accounting method used to allocate the cost of a tangible or physical asset over its useful life.
Straight-Line Method
A method of calculating depreciation of an asset evenly across its useful life, where the same amount is expensed each year.
Accumulated Depreciation
The cumulative total of depreciation charges applied to a fixed asset from the time of its acquisition.
